Transaction 11622d50440771c072c259869235fed137e4a85bcafcca2dfcce35eb4e804f4c
1 Input
2 Outputs
- 11622d50440771c072c259869235fed137e4a85bcafcca2dfcce35eb4e804f4c:0
- 11622d50440771c072c259869235fed137e4a85bcafcca2dfcce35eb4e804f4c:1
value 22000000
address 1KVmwdiYD2aP7a51bT1JS3W1gDoWJZ7Bu6
value 976571
address 13wHMtnc4pcfd6m6S9EsbLhnYWJ8vfyjFE